There is a warmboot exploit known as Deja Vu that works up to firmwares 4.1 and makes no use of the gc slot. However it will require a network connection making it wirelessly tethered. Keeping the gc slot not updated is useful for an exploit that makes use of something being inserted in there such as a game however there is no such exploit as of yet.

Will that mean that with Atmosphere there will be no way for Nintendo to detect homebrew, and at the same time being able to use our legally owned games online? Is that what it means?
I have absolutely no idea where you got that from. The way homebrew is currently designed now makes use of developing based on Horizon. However, we do not have the source code for Horizon so development based off of it is based off of observational data and whatever we can reverse engineer. On the other hand, Atmosphere's source code will be available as well as removing all of the limits of the original Switch OS to allow homebrew devs the full capacity of the Switch with as few barriers as possible.
